/* queue.c
|
|
|
|
Implementation of a FIFO queue abstract data type.
|
|
*/

#include <stdio.h>
|
|
#include <stdbool.h>
|
|
|
|
#include "queue.h"
|
|
|
|
void init_queue(queue *q) {
|
|
q->first = 0;
|
|
q->last = QUEUESIZE - 1;
|
|
q->count = 0;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void enqueue(queue *q, item_type x) {
|
|
if (q->count >= QUEUESIZE) {
|
|
printf("Warning: queue overflow enqueue x=%d\n", x);
|
|
} else {
|
|
q->last = (q->last + 1) % QUEUESIZE;
|
|
q->q[q->last] = x;
|
|
q->count = q->count + 1;
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
item_type dequeue(queue *q) {
|
|
item_type x;
|
|
|
|
if (q->count <= 0) printf("Warning: empty queue dequeue.\n");
|
|
|
|
x = q->q[q->first];
|
|
q->first = (q->first + 1) % QUEUESIZE;
|
|
q->count = q->count - 1;
|
|
|
|
return(x);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
item_type headq(queue *q) {
|
|
return(q->q[q->first]);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
int empty_queue(queue *q) {
|
|
if (q->count <= 0) {
|
|
return (true);
|
|
}
|
|
return (false);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void print_queue(queue *q) {
|
|
int i;
|
|
|
|
i = q->first;
|
|
|
|
while (i != q->last) {
|
|
printf("%d ", q->q[i]);
|
|
i = (i + 1) % QUEUESIZE;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
printf("%2d ", q->q[i]);
|
|
printf("\n");
|
|
}
